AGENDA TITLE: Adopt Resolution Authorizing Procurementof Two Padmounted Liquid Insulated Vacuum
Switchgearwith Fault Interruptersfrom Trayer Engineering Corporation of San Francisco,
California ($72,000) (EUD)
MEETING DATE: September 1,2010
PREPARED BY: Electric Utility Director
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Adopt a resolution authorizing procurementof two padmounted, liquid
insulated, vacuum switchgearwith fault interrupters from Trayer
Engineering Corporation of San Francisco, California in an amount not to
exceed $72,000.
BACKGROUND INFORMATION: The Reynolds Ranch Development Project requiresthe installation of two
padmounted, liquid -insulated, vacuum switchgear with fault interruptersfor
the Costco site. Switchgear is not an inventory item and is purchased on
an as -needed basis. The equipmentallows the utilityto complete the line extension in Reynolds Ranch
Development Project for Costco construction.
On May 5, 2010, the City Council awarded the procurement of three padmounted switchgear to Trayer Engineering
Corporation for the DeBenedetti Park Project Phase 1 with one as a spare. The proposal by Trayer complied with
the technical specifications and was the only bid received.
The Electric Utility Department (EUD) has been using Trayer padmounted switchgear in the City's electrical
distribution system for more than 10 years. According to EUD's construction division, the equipment has proven
easy and safe to operate with minimum maintenance. Staff considers Trayer's July 2010 price quotes reasonable
and within the estimated budget. Lodi Municipal Code §3.20.070 authorizes dispensing with bids for purchases of
supplies, services, or equipment when certain criteria are met. Cost savings are realized when EU D's inventory can
be kept to a minimum by utilizing one manufacturerfor switchgear.
Due to the long -lead time of this equipment, staff recommends City Council approval of a resolution to award the
procurement of two padmounted, liquid—insulated, vacuum switchgear with fault interruptersto Trayer in an amount
not to exceed $72,000 including tax and shipping.
FISCAL IMPACT: Procurement cost will be recovered from future developmentthrough the City's Full Cost
Recovery Rule in accordance with Resolution No. 2006-234, resulting in no net cost to
EUD.
FUNDING: Included in FYA10/11 Budget Account No. 161652.
